How to Make Berry Blue Jello Cloud Mousse

Here are the ingredients you need to make this berry blue Jello cloud mousse, plus step by step instructions for how to make it.

Ingredients

  • 3 oz package berry blue Jello
  • 2 cups water, divided
  • 8 oz container whipped topping, thawed
  • 1 tsp blue sugar sprinkles

Step by Step Instructions

1. Pour the berry blue Jello powder into a medium-sized, heat-safe mixing bowl.

2. Pour 1 cup of water into a medium saucepan and bring to a boil over high heat. Pour the hot water over the Jello powder. Use a whisk or spoon to stir the mixture for about 2-3 minutes, making sure the gelatin completely dissolves. You’ll know it’s ready when the liquid is smooth and clear, without any grainy texture.

3. Add 1 cup of cold water to the dissolved gelatin mixture and give it a quick stir. This helps cool down the mixture and sets the gelatin properly.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and place it in the refrigerator. Let it chill for at least 4 hours, or until the Jello is firm and completely set.

4. Once the Jello has set, it’s time to put together the mousse cups. Grab your serving cups. Spoon a layer of the gelatin into the bottom of each cup. Then, add a layer of whipped topping. Continue layering, alternating Jello and whipped topping, until you have 3-4 layers, finishing with whipped topping on top.

5. For a little extra flair, add a dollop of whipped topping on the very top layer. Top with blue sugar sprinkles to give it a festive look.

6. Serve and enjoy (keep refrigerated until ready to serve).
